LINE DISTANCE PROTECTION SYSTEM – INSTRUCTION MANUAL
INTER-RELAY COMMUNICATIONS CHAPTER 6: COMMUNICATIONS
Select the Actual Values > Communications > Inter-Relay Transceivers menu to open
the inter-relay communication actual values window.
Figure 150: Inter-relay communication actual values
The following actual values are available for each channel.
Transceiver Temperature
Range: –99.99 to 300.00 °C
This value indicates the fiber transceiver temperature.
Transceiver Temperature Trouble
Range: On, Off
This value indicates whether the fiber transceiver temperature has exceeded the
manufacturer’s limit.
Transceiver Voltage
Range: 0.0000 to 6.5535 V in steps of 0.0001
This value indicates the fiber transceiver voltage.
Voltage Trouble
Range: On, Off
This value indicates whether the fiber transceiver voltage level is outside the
manufacturer’s limit.
Transmit Bias Current
Range: 0 to 65535 μA in steps of 1
This value indicates the fiber transceiver bias current level.
Transmit Bias Current Trouble
Range: On, Off
This value indicates whether the fiber transceiver bias current is outside the
manufacturer’s limit.
Transmit Power Level
Range: –3276.8 to 3276.8 dBm in steps of 0.1
This value indicates the fiber transceiver transmitter power level.
